Adam Brockdorff has joined SiGMA – a gaming and emerging tech events company – as Marketing Director.
Founded by Eman Pulis, SiGMA is nowadays a leading international hub for all things iGaming, such as regulation, marketing, and responsible gambling.
The company has its roots in an iGaming conference hosted on the Maltese islands in 2014, attended by around 1,000 delegates. Since then, SiGMA has grown exponentially and internationally, hosting industry-related events all over the globe.
SiGMA now employs over 80 workers and has offices in Malta, Cyprus, London, Manila, Belgrade, the United Arab Emirates, and Chicago.
Mr Brockdorff joined the company following a 12-year tenure at BPC International Ltd in Malta, throughout which he served as Account Executive and, eventually, Manager.
